Catskill Steve offers his picks for the $25,000 Pick-4 at Balmoral Park on Aug. 31, part of the U.S. Trotting Association Strategic Wagering Program.

Balmoral Park Pick-4, Races 7-10, Sunday, Aug. 31, 2014

$1 play: 45/26/56/5 = $8

Analysis:

Race 7: (4) Fox Valley Ruby had pace finishing in fast mile following a sharp two move try from 10 hole two back. (5) Lima Calliope is a hard luck mare that was overmatched in scorching Hoosier miles and impeded against tougher here two back. Returns and drops to the level of a sharp placing here on July 27, just missing despite finishing in :26.4.

Race 8: (6) Sunset Dreamer was used hard to get the top from post nine, yielded to chase fast pace and missed by less than two lengths. (2) Native Lights is a Maywood shipper who blasted to the top from post seven, was used rebuffing backstretch challenge and dug in to hold sway and earn second career win. Switches back to mile track and can continue to move forward for high percentage barn.

Race 9: (5) One Jazzy Lady had tough spot in latest after showing speed and folding against top Indiana stakes fillies two back. The 3-year-old finds better spot, gets Hall of Fame pilot back and has shown sharp speed and quick brushes in a number of her sophomore starts. (6) Our Miss Special had little at Hoosier last time after pacing a 1:24.1 final three-quarters, recovering from early miscue to miss by a length and a half against some of these two back. Should be following live cover from this spot and may be tough to hold off in the late stages.

Race 10: (5) Karma Kween had steady rally from post 10, closing off a slow pace in race she likely needed. Gets better post and could make a move forward for strong barn.
